Fiorentina 2-0 Liverpool

Liverpool suffered defeat in Italy to Fiorentina in their second Champions League group match.

Young forward Stevan Jovetic scored twice in the first half as Rafa Benitez’s side were made to pay for a below-par performance.

Jovetic slotted past Pepe Reina after being played onside by Emiliano Insua, and later flicked in a low shot/cross to double the lead for the home side.

Missing Javier Mascherano, Benitez deployed Fabio Aurelio alongside Lucas Leiva but the two of them failed to offer much protection for the back four, who themselves struggled again.

The second half saw a much improved performance but the hosts were happy to defend deep and defend well to keep hold of their lead. They did so despite constant pressure and possession from Liverpool.

Rafa Benitez looked clearly unhappy at full-time and will be keen to take a look at the defensive problems ahead of Sunday’s trip to Stamford Bridge.
